A masterwork of design and craftsmanship on four pristine acres, Angophora Lodge is a gated estate of rare sophistication backing directly onto Ku-ring-gai National Park, where boundless bushland panoramas unfold from every elevation of this award-winning residence.

Concealed behind private gates on one of the Northern Beaches' most prestigious rural addresses, the property has been meticulously finished to an extraordinary standard, earning recognition as HIA-CSR NSW Home of the Year and CEDIA Best Integrated Home. Every surface reveals an obsessive attention to material and detail, with premium natural timbers, imported stone and bespoke finishes combining to create interiors of warmth, texture and enduring beauty.

The grand main residence opens to a lounge anchored by a full sandstone fireplace, flowing through to expansive casual living and dining, a games room with home cinema, bespoke bar and custom billiards table. A deluxe stone kitchen fitted with a full suite of Miele appliances connects seamlessly to wraparound alfresco terraces via full glass bi-fold doors, with an outdoor kitchen perfectly positioned for entertaining on a grand scale. The sublime master wing delivers hotel-calibre luxury with a full marble ensuite and generous dressing room, while additional bedrooms, a custom home office and beautifully appointed main bathroom complete the main house.

Outdoors, the professionally curated gardens dissolve into the national park beyond, creating the sensation of a private wilderness retreat. A spectacular lagoon-style swimming pool with waterfall, spa deck and cabana forms the centrepiece of the grounds, complemented by a floodlit championship-sized tennis court, infrared sauna and expansive alfresco entertaining areas with firepit. A separate two-bedroom guesthouse with enormous, professionally soundproofed rumpus offers complete independence for visitors, staff or extended family.

The estate is underpinned by comprehensive C-Bus and Control4 automation, providing seamless control of audio-visual, lighting, security and blinds throughout the entire property. Secure parking accommodates in excess of ten vehicles, with a triple lock-up garage and extensive ancillary garaging offering flexibility for use as stables, equipment storage or gymnasium. A horse paddock backing onto Duck Holes Trail, herb and vegetable gardens and abundant rainwater storage round out a property designed for complete self-sufficiency.

Wonderfully secluded yet supremely connected, Angophora Lodge is moments to Terrey Hills village and bus services, within easy reach of elite schools including Barker College, Knox Grammar, Pymble Ladies' College and Abbotsleigh, and less than twenty minutes to the Northern Beaches coastline.
